当前位置: 首页 手游资讯 开发语言资讯

js代码格式化在线

js代码格式化在线

在编写JavaScript代码时格式化是一项非常重要的任务。良好的代码格式可以提高代码的可读性和可维护性,让其他开发人员更容易理解和修改代码。

为了帮助开发人员快速进行代码格式化,我们可以使用在线的JavaScript代码格式化工具。这些工具通常采用各种算法和规则,根据编码风格和个人偏好来调整代码的格式。

一个非常常用的在线JavaScript代码格式化工具是“js代码格式化在线”。这个工具提供了简单易用的界面,可以将压缩和混淆过的JavaScript代码转换为可读性更高的格式。

使用“js代码格式化在线”很简单。我们需要将待格式化的JavaScript代码粘贴到界面的输入框中。点击“格式化”按钮,工具就会立即开始对代码进行格式化操作并在输出框中显示结果。

“js代码格式化在线”支持多种代码格式化选项,可以根据需要进行自定义设置。我们可以选择是否在代码中保留注释是否对代码进行缩进,以及使用何种缩进字符等。

“js代码格式化在线”还提供了实时预览功能,可以在格式化代码之前查看预览效果。我们可以根据需要进行修改和调整,以满足特定的代码格式要求。

除了以上提到的功能,“js代码格式化在线”还具有许多其他实用的特性。可以处理大型代码文件,无论代码有多长或多复杂,都可以快速准确地进行格式化。还支持多种代码模式,可以格式化JavaScript、TypeScript和CoffeeScript等不同类型的代码。

“js代码格式化在线”还提供了一些高级功能,如批量格式化、自动保存和历史记录等。这些功能可以帮助开发人员更好地管理和处理代码,提高工作效率。

js代码格式化快捷键

JS代码格式化是一项非常重要的技能,可以使代码更易于阅读和维护。在编写JS代码时我们经常需要对代码进行格式化,以使代码结构清晰、缩进一致并确保代码易于理解。

许多代码编辑器和集成开发环境(IDE)都提供了快捷键来格式化JS代码。本文将介绍几种常见的JS代码格式化快捷键并探讨如何在不同的编辑器和IDE中使用它们。

让我们来看一下在许多编辑器和IDE中通用的JS代码格式化快捷键。其中最常用的是“Ctrl + Shift + F”(Windows)或“Cmd + Shift + F”(macOS)。这个快捷键组合会触发代码格式化操作并根据默认的代码样式规范对代码进行格式化。按下这个组合键后编辑器将自动调整缩进、添加适当的空格和换行符并使代码按照统一的风格显示。

如果你对默认的代码样式规范不满意,可以在编辑器的设置中进行自定义。你可以选择设置不同的缩进宽度、选择花括号的位置(同行或下一行)、选择单引号还是双引号等等。编辑器会根据你的设置自动应用这些样式并在格式化代码时按照你的要求进行处理。

除了通用的快捷键外,一些编辑器和IDE还提供了其他的JS代码格式化快捷键。在Visual Studio Code(VS Code)中,你可以使用“Shift + Alt + F”快捷键来格式化选定的代码块。这对于只想格式化部分代码而不是整个文件的情况非常有用。

在Sublime Text编辑器中,你可以使用“Ctrl + Alt + F”快捷键来格式化整个文件,或使用“Ctrl + Shift + K”快捷键来删除代码中的空行。这些快捷键可以帮助你更轻松地处理代码的结构和布局。

除了这些快捷键之外,一些IDE和编辑器还提供了插件或扩展,可以进一步定制和优化JS代码的格式化。Prettier是一个非常流行的代码格式化工具,可以与许多编辑器和IDE集成并提供更多的格式化选项和配置。通过安装和配置Prettier插件,你可以轻松地在编辑器中使用自定义的格式化规范并自动应用它们。

在线js代码格式化工具

在线JS代码格式化工具是一种非常实用的工具,可以帮助开发者在编写JavaScript代码时保持代码的格式整洁、易读。在日常的开发工作中,代码的可读性是非常重要的,因为代码的阅读和维护是开发者花费大量时间的工作。一个格式良好的代码可以提高代码的可读性,减少出错的概率并且提高开发效率。

在线JS代码格式化工具的工作原理很简单,可以根据预定的格式规则来调整代码的缩进、换行、空格等,使代码更加工整。有了这个工具,开发者可以很方便地格式化自己编写的JavaScript代码,不再需要手动调整缩进和空格。开发者可以更加专注于代码的逻辑,不必花费过多的时间来调整代码的格式。

在线JS代码格式化工具通常提供了一些可选的格式化规则,开发者可以根据自己的习惯选择适合自己的规则。开发者可以选择使用空格或者制表符来进行缩进,也可以设置缩进的数量,也能选择是否在代码块之间插入空行等等。这些选项可以根据个人的喜好进行调整,以达到最佳的编码效果。

除了格式化代码外,线JS代码格式化工具还可以进行语法检查,帮助开发者发现代码中的潜在问题。可以检测错误的括号配对、缺少分号、未定义的变量等问题并给出相应的提示。这对于开发者来说是非常有帮助的,可以帮助他们提前发现一些隐藏的bug,减少调试的时间和精力。

在线JS代码格式化工具还支持批量格式化,开发者可以一次性格式化多个文件,提高工作效率。还可以和其他开发工具集成,比如代码编辑器、集成开发环境等,方便开发者在开发过程中随时格式化代码。

js代码格式化在线

在编写JavaScript代码时保持代码的格式整洁和易读非常重要。良好的代码格式可以提高代码的可维护性和可读性并且能够帮助开发者更好地理解和调试代码。为了方便开发者进行代码格式化,有许多在线工具提供了JavaScript代码格式化的功能。

JavaScript代码格式化在线工具可以帮助开发者自动调整代码的缩进、空格、换行等,以提供更统一的代码风格。下面介绍几个常用的JavaScript代码格式化在线工具。

1. Prettier

Prettier 是一个非常受欢迎的代码格式化工具,支持多种编程语言,包括JavaScript。提供了一个在线网页版的代码格式化工具,用户只需将代码粘贴到文本框中,点击格式化按钮即可得到格式化后的代码。Prettier 可以根据预设的规则对代码进行格式化并且可以根据用户的需求进行个性化配置。

2. JS Beautifier

JS Beautifier 是另一个常用的JavaScript代码格式化工具,提供了一个在线网页版的格式化工具,用户可以将代码粘贴到文本框中,选择相应的格式化选项(如缩进大小、换行符等),然后点击格式化按钮即可得到格式化后的代码。JS Beautifier 支持多种编程语言的代码格式化并且提供了大量的格式化选项,可以满足不同开发者的需求。

3. ESLint

ESLint 是一个流行的JavaScript代码检查工具,可以帮助开发者发现并修复代码中的潜在问题。ESLint 还可以进行代码格式化并提供了一些预设的格式化规则。用户可以通过在命令行中运行 ESLint并指定格式化选项来对 JavaScript 代码进行格式化。ESLint 的格式化功能可以与其他工具(如编辑器插件)结合使用,以实现实时的代码格式化和错误提示。

js代码格式化工具

JavaScript是一种广泛使用的脚本语言,用于为网页添加交互和动态功能。开发人员编写的代码在实际应用中可能会变得复杂而难以阅读和维护。使用js代码格式化工具可以帮助开发人员提高代码的可读性和可维护性。

js代码格式化工具是一种自动化工具,可以根据预定的规则对JavaScript代码进行格式化。这些规则可以包括缩进、换行、空格、括号等方面的设置。通过使用这些工具,代码可以以一致的风格显示,提高代码的可读性。

格式化工具可以帮助开发人员提高代码的可读性。通过对代码进行缩进和换行,可以使代码块更易于理解。代码块之间的垂直间距能够清晰地分隔不同的功能和逻辑,使代码更易于阅读。工具可以自动对代码进行对齐和增加空格,使代码更易于理解。这些调整可以让开发人员更加专注于代码的逻辑,不用花费过多的精力去理解和解读代码的格式。

格式化工具能够提高代码的可维护性。通过对代码进行格式化,可以更容易地识别和修复错误。在代码格式化的过程中,工具会自动检测和标记潜在的问题,包括拼写错误、语法错误和逻辑错误等。这有助于开发人员及时发现和纠正问题并减少在调试和测试过程中的时间和精力。通过对代码进行格式化,可以使代码更易于扩展和修改。开发人员可以更快地找到和理解所需的代码区域,从而更快地进行修改和添加新的功能。

格式化工具可以提高代码的一致性。在团队开发中,不同开发人员可能会按照自己的偏好和习惯编写代码,导致代码的样式不一致。这样的问题不仅影响代码的可读性和可维护性,还会增加团队协作和代码审查的难度。通过使用格式化工具,可以在团队中建立统一的代码风格和规范,确保所有成员编写的代码风格一致。这不仅提高了代码的可读性也有助于团队成员之间的交流和合作。

格式化工具并不是万能的,只能帮助我们提高代码的可读性和可维护性。在使用格式化工具时我们仍然需要确保代码的质量和逻辑正确性。格式化工具只是辅助工具,开发人员仍然需要具备良好的编码习惯和代码规范。

js代码格式化原理

JS代码格式化原理

JavaScript(简称JS)是一种常用的脚本语言,用于为网页添加动态功能和交互性。在开发过程中,代码的可读性非常重要,因为清晰、易读的代码可以提高代码维护和开发效率。而JS代码格式化就是通过一定的规则和算法,将代码按照一定的格式进行重新排版,以提高代码的可读性。

JS代码格式化的原理主要包括以下几个方面:

1. 代码词法分析:

代码词法分析是将源代码划分为一个个token的过程。在JS中,token包括关键字、标识符、运算符、分隔符、字符串、数字等。通过词法分析,可以将源代码按照token的规则进行划分,为后续的格式化提供基础。

2. 代码语法分析:

代码语法分析是将token组织成一棵抽象语法树(AST)的过程。AST是对代码结构的一种抽象表示,通过将代码按照语法规则进行组织,可以更好地理解代码的结构和逻辑。通过语法分析,可以将代码按照语法规则进行重新组织,为后续的格式化提供便利。

3. 代码格式化规则:

代码格式化规则是指在格式化过程中,对代码进行重新排版的规则。对代码进行缩进、代码块的换行、空格的添加等。常见的代码格式化规则包括使用缩进来表示代码块的层级关系、在函数和条件语句的括号前后添加空格、在运算符前后添加空格等。通过制定一套统一的代码格式化规则,可以使代码在整体上看起来更加清晰、易读。

4. 代码格式化算法:

代码格式化算法是指根据代码词法分析和语法分析的结果,按照代码格式化规则对代码进行重排版的算法。常见的格式化算法包括遍历抽象语法树并根据节点类型和深度来添加缩进、根据特定的符号进行换行等。通过格式化算法,可以将代码按照一定的规则进行排版,提高代码的可读性。

通过以上过程,JS代码格式化可以将原本杂乱无章的代码重新排版,使之具备一定的可读性。代码格式化不仅仅是对代码进行美化,更是为了提高代码的可读性和可维护性。格式化后的代码可以使团队成员更容易理解和修改代码,减少代码错误和bug的产生。

标签: js 代码 格式化

声明:

1、本文来源于互联网,所有内容仅代表作者本人的观点,与本网站立场无关,作者文责自负。

2、本网站部份内容来自互联网收集整理,对于不当转载或引用而引起的民事纷争、行政处理或其他损失,本网不承担责任。

3、如果有侵权内容、不妥之处,请第一时间联系我们删除,请联系

  1. 摸鱼游乐园最新版VS地铁跑酷灰色版本
  2. 契约宠物精灵梦幻VS大熊航空旅行
  3. 沙盒故事VS无尽战神
  4. 冰之诸神领域VS小猪甜蜜消
  5. 忍者闯魔城VS天行宝贝
  6. 大唐奇迹sf版VS三国猛将传之主公别浪
  7. 神道仙游记VS风暴召唤师礼包版
  8. kingdom圣战预兆游戏VS会动的刀片游戏
  9. 命运竞技场VS内购官方正版VS猫来了之喵星物语测试版
  10. 剑雨逍遥手游VS骑士王国的魔法宝石
  11. 九天仙梦逆天修行VSshell racing apk
  12. 抖音东方妖神录VS一杆进洞